Eat Like a Local: Must-Try Foods in Département de l'Artibonite, Haiti
Indulge in the rich culinary traditions of Artibonite. Sample local specialties like griot (fried pork), diri kole (sticky rice), and fresh seafood from the coast. Best Time to Visit Département de l'Artibonite, Haiti
The best time to visit is during the dry season (November to April) for pleasant weather and easier travel. However, each season offers a unique experience. Check the weather forecast before your trip and pack accordingly.
